2nd image in a three image sequence.
Get up real close (almost lifesize macro) to the rose in image #1. Rotate the camera using a long exposure (4 sec.). Using a lens with a tripod collar makes this easy; Nikkor 75-300 with Canon 500D closeup lens, f40 (to get a long exposure), at 300mm (to get real close).
Looks like a pink whirlpool. I like this image enough to use it all alone - not as part of a montage.
